From Danny Wielder in the SMH

Stewart back in Sydney
After a stint in Melbourne as an owner and manager of a restaurant, one of the Sea Eagles’ greatest players, Brett Stewart, is back in town. Stewart still has his Melbourne business but is now working in Sydney for a company that Bob Fulton owns. With Des Hasler back at the Eagles, it will be interesting to see if Stewart re-involves himself with his club.
